How to Tie The Usual

What You’ll Need

Hook

Tiemco 101, size 12-16

Thread

Uni-Thread 6/0, red

Body

Snowshoe rabbit (natural)

TAIL

Snowshoe rabbit (natural)
VERY SIMPLE TIE AND IT CATCHES FISH EVERYWHERE YOU GO. THIS PATTERN IS ONE THAT GET’S LOST, BUT ONE YOU SHOULD NEVER FORGET TO FISH.

Step 1

Start the thread at the front. Leave enough room because dubbing will be applied in front, but under the snowshoe rabbit that will be hanging off the front.

Step 2

Cut some hair off the rabbit and measure to hang off the front about half the length of the hook shank. The rabbit is kind of like deer hair in the sense that you need to pull out the guard hair before tying it down. If you don’t you will have excess hair at the ends that won’t secure really well to the hook shank. When tying the hair in you’ll have some pointing towards the bend. What you’ll want to do is make a cut with your scissors at an angle. Then tie it all down with thread wraps. This will build a center body.

Step 3

Your thread should be at the bend. Repeat the same step as step two. After your done the center should be even from making the cut at an angle. Advance the thread back to the bend and your ready to add dubbing.

Step 4

With a fur rake you’ll comb some dubbing out from the rabbit foot. You don’t need to cut any hair. Just put the fur rake close to the hide and rake some out.

Showing you how the hair comes right out from using a fur rake.

Step 5

Dub some around the thread and wind it up until you get to the front.

Step 6

Now lift the front of the hair and make a few turns in front. The will force the tail to lift up.

Step 7

Whip finish the fly and add some glue.
